Freigeben über


Schritt 2: Ein Treiberpaket für das Gerät ist ausgewählt

Nachdem ein neues Gerät erkannt und identifiziert wurde, führen Windows und die zugehörigen Geräteinstallationskomponenten die folgenden Schritte aus:

  1. Windows sucht nach dem passenden Treiberpaket für das Gerät. Weitere Informationen zu diesem Schritt finden Sie unter Suchen nach einem Treiberpaket.
  2. Windows wählt die am besten geeigneten Treiberpakete für das Gerät aus einem oder mehreren Treiberpaketen aus. Weitere Informationen zu diesem Schritt finden Sie unter Auswählen des Treibers.

Suchen nach einem Treiberpaket

Mithilfe der Hardware-IDs (IDs) und kompatiblen IDs , die vom Bustreiber für das Gerät gemeldet werden, sucht Windows nach Treiberpaketen , die diesem Gerät entsprechen. Ein Treiberpaket stimmt mit einem Gerät überein, wenn eine Hardware-ID oder eine kompatible ID auf dem Gerät mit einer ID in einem INF-Abschnittseintrag der INF-Datei des Treiberpakets übereinstimmt.

Wenn ein Benutzer beispielsweise auf Windows 8 und höher einen WLAN-Adapter an einen Port eines USB-Hubs ansteckt, werden die folgenden Schritte ausgeführt:

  • Nachdem der USB-Hubtreiber eine Liste der Hardware-IDs und kompatiblen IDs für den WLAN-Adapter erstellt hat, durchsucht Windows zunächst den Treiberspeicher nach einem passenden Treiberpaket für das Gerät. Wenn im Treiberspeicher ein Treiberpaket gefunden wird, installiert Windows es auf dem Gerät. Dadurch kann das Gerät schnell mit der Arbeit beginnen.

  • In einem separaten Prozess durchsucht Windows Windows Update und den DevicePath nach einem treiber, der besser zu dem passt, was aus dem Treiberspeicher installiert wurde. Wenn eine gefunden wird, wird der Treiber im Treiberspeicher bereitgestellt und dann auf dem Gerät installiert.

Weitere Informationen zum Suchprozess für Treiberpakete finden Sie unter Wo Windows nach Treibern sucht.

Hinweis

Ab Windows Vista installiert das Betriebssystem immer ein Treiberpaket aus dem Treiberspeicher. Wenn ein übereinstimmende Treiberpaket an einem anderen Speicherort gefunden wird, übergibt Windows das Paket zunächst in den Treiberspeicher, bevor das Treiberpaket auf einem Gerät installiert wird.

Auswählen des Treibers

Sobald Windows ein oder mehrere übereinstimmende Treiberpakete für das Gerät gefunden hat, wählt Windows das beste Treiberpaket aus, indem er die folgenden Schritte ausführt:

  1. Wenn Windows nur ein passendes Treiberpaket gefunden hat, wird dieses Treiberpaket auf dem Gerät installiert.

  2. Wenn Windows mehrere übereinstimmende Treiberpakete gefunden hat, weist Windows zunächst jeder Übereinstimmung aus jedem Treiberpaket einen Rangfolgewert zu. Wenn nur ein Treiber über den niedrigsten Rang verfügt, wird dieses Treiberpaket auf dem Gerät installiert.

    Weitere Informationen zum Bewertungsprozess finden Sie unter Rangfolge von Treibern in Windows.

  3. Wenn mehrere Treiberpakete denselben niedrigsten Rang aufweisen, verwendet Windows das Treiberdatum und die Version, um das beste Treiberpaket für das Gerät auszuwählen. Das Datum und die Version werden von der INF DriverVer-Direktive angegeben, die in der INF-Datei des Treiberpakets enthalten ist.

Nachdem Windows ein Treiberpaket für das Gerät ausgewählt hat, installiert Windows das Treiberpaket wie in Schritt 3: Der Treiber für das Gerät ist installiert.